βυβλίον

Second declension Noun; Neuter 자동번역 Transliteration:

Principal Part: βυβλίον

Structure: βυβλι (Stem) + ον (Ending)

Sense

  1. Strip of papyrus
  2. Small book, tablet, letter
  3. Any book or writing

Examples

  • παράδειγμα δὲ ποιοῦμαι τῆσ γε ὑψηλῆσ λέξεωσ ἐξ ἑνὸσ βυβλίου τῶν πάνυ περιβοήτων, ἐν ᾧ τοὺσ ἐρωτικοὺσ διατίθεται λόγουσ ὁ Σωκράτησ πρὸσ ἕνα τῶν γνωρίμων Φαῖδρον, ἀφ’ οὗ τὴν ἐπιγραφὴν εἴληφε τὸ βυβλίον. (Dionysius of Halicarnassus, De Demosthene, chapter 7 1:1)
  • εἰσὶ γὰρ ἀληθῶσ ὅμοιοι τοῖσ ἐκ βυβλίου κυβερνῶσιν· (Polybius, Histories, book 12, chapter 25d 6:1)
